No description
Find a file
2026-02-02 13:40:12 -06:00
extensions Re-read SOUL.md on every prompt for live updates 2026-02-02 13:40:12 -06:00
install.sh Initial setup: extensions, skills, install script 2026-02-02 13:32:36 -06:00
README.md Make soul extension generic, follow SOUL.md standard 2026-02-02 13:38:31 -06:00
settings.json Initial setup: extensions, skills, install script 2026-02-02 13:32:36 -06:00
SOUL.md Make soul extension generic, follow SOUL.md standard 2026-02-02 13:38:31 -06:00

pi-agent

Personal configuration for pi coding agent.

Structure

pi-agent/
├── extensions/       # Custom tools and event handlers
│   ├── brave-search.ts
│   └── soul.ts       # SOUL.md loader
├── skills/           # On-demand capability packages
├── SOUL.md           # AI identity and values (see soul.md)
├── settings.json     # Reference settings (not symlinked)
└── install.sh        # Setup script

Installation

git clone https://github.com/mikeyobrien/pi-agent.git ~/projects/pi-agent
cd ~/projects/pi-agent
./install.sh

Extensions

  • brave-search.ts - Web search via Brave Search API

Environment Variables

export BRAVE_API_KEY="your-key"  # Required for brave-search